What Exactly Are DeFi Technologies?
At its core, DeFi technologies refer to the suite of decentralized applications, protocols, and smart contracts that replicate traditional financial services on public blockchains. Instead of relying on banks, brokers, or clearinghouses, users interact directly with code that executes transactions automatically when predefined conditions are met.
The beauty of this model lies in its openness. Anyone with a crypto wallet and an internet connection can access lending markets, swap tokens, earn yield, or insure digital assets — no paperwork, no geographic restrictions, no gatekeepers. This radical accessibility is what makes DeFi one of the most disruptive fintech movements of the decade.
By mid-decade, the total value locked in DeFi protocols has climbed into the hundreds of billions, a clear signal that capital is migrating toward trustless, programmable money.
Core Building Blocks Powering the DeFi Ecosystem
DeFi doesn't run on hype alone — it's engineered on a stack of foundational technologies that work in concert. Understanding these components is key to grasping why the space moves so fast.
Smart Contracts
Smart contracts are self-executing programs stored on a blockchain. They handle everything from loan collateralization to automated market making, removing the need for human intermediaries. Ethereum remains the dominant platform, but Solana, Avalanche, and BNB Chain are gaining serious traction.
Oracles and Price Feeds
Blockchains can't access external data on their own. Oracles like Chainlink bridge that gap, feeding real-world asset prices into smart contracts so lending, derivatives, and stablecoin systems function reliably.
Decentralized Storage and Interoperability
Cross-chain bridges and decentralized storage networks ensure that value and data can move freely between isolated blockchain ecosystems. Without them, DeFi would be a collection of walled gardens rather than a unified financial layer.
Top DeFi Technologies Reshaping Finance Right Now
While the DeFi universe is vast, several technologies are emerging as clear frontrunners in driving real-world adoption and capital flows.
- Decentralized Exchanges (DEXs): Automated market makers like Uniswap and Curve have turned token swapping into a frictionless, 24/7 experience — no order books, no centralized custody.
- Lending and Borrowing Protocols: Platforms such as Aave and Compound let users lend idle crypto to earn interest or borrow against collateral in minutes, often at rates far better than traditional banks.
- Yield Farming and Liquidity Mining: Users provide liquidity to protocols and earn rewards in return, creating powerful incentive loops that bootstrap new financial primitives.
- Liquid Staking Derivatives: Tokens like Lido's stETH let users stake assets while keeping them liquid and usable across DeFi — solving one of crypto's oldest capital-efficiency problems.
- Real World Asset (RWA) Tokenization: Bringing treasuries, real estate, and private credit on-chain is bridging DeFi yields with traditional finance, unlocking trillions in latent value.

Risks, Challenges, and the Road Ahead
For all its promise, DeFi technologies come with real risks. Smart contract bugs can lead to nine-figure exploits, oracle manipulation remains a persistent threat, and regulatory uncertainty continues to cast a shadow over the industry's future.
Yet the pace of innovation is relentless. Account abstraction is simplifying onboarding, zero-knowledge proofs are bringing privacy and scalability, and AI-driven risk engines are beginning to monitor protocol health in real time. Together, these advances are pushing DeFi closer to mainstream usability.
As institutional players dip deeper into on-chain finance and regulators craft clearer frameworks, the next wave of DeFi technologies will likely look less like a wild frontier and more like a robust, integrated layer of the global economy.
